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| North American Badger | Winter Truffle |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Animalia (Animals) | Fungi (Fungi)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Ascomycota (Sac Fungi)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Pezizomycetes (Pezizomycetes) |
| Order | Carnivora (Carnivorans) | Pezizales (Pezizales) |
| Family | Mustelidae (Weasels & Otters) | Tuberaceae |
| Genus | Taxidea | Tuber |
| Species | Taxidea taxus | Tuber brumale |
